Alcaeus to Sappho by Samuel Taylor Coleridge

Alcaeus to Sappho Annotated

How sweet, when crimson colours dart
&nbspAcross a breast of snow,
To see that you are in the heart
&nbspThat beats and throbs below.

All Heaven is in a maiden's blush,
&nbspIn which the soul doth speak,
That it was you who sent the flush
&nbspInto the maiden's cheek.

Large steadfast eyes! eyes gently rolled
&nbspIn shades of changing blue,
How sweet are they, if they behold
&nbspNo dearer sight than you.

And, can a lip more richly glow,
&nbspOr be more fair than this?
The world will surely answer, No!
&nbspI, Sappho, answer, Yes!

Then grant one smile, tho' it should mean
&nbspA thing of doubtful birth;
That I may say these eyes have seen
&nbspThe fairest face on earth!
